Smiles for Students: Back-to-School Drive
We are proud to partner with Pepsi this summer for Smiles for Students, a back-to-school drive to support youth in the Corona-Norco Unified School District who are experiencing foster care, homelessness, poverty, or domestic violence.
Through July 15, 2025, we’re collecting new school supplies, clothing essentials, and hygiene items to help over 700 students start the school year with confidence and care.
Who We're Supporting
This drive specifically benefits students connected to All Stars (foster youth) and Club Hope (students experiencing homelessness)—two vital programs within the district plus select students who are experiencing domestic violence at home.

What We Need Most
We’re collecting a wide range of clothing, hygiene items, and school supplies for boys, girls, teens, and young adults. Key needs include:
Clothing:
Shirts, pants, shorts, underwear, bras, jackets, shoes (sizes for all age groups)
Toiletries:
Shampoo, conditioner, body wash, deodorant, combs/brushes, diapers
School Supplies:
Backpacks, notebooks, binders, paper, pencils, dividers, colored pencils
